Tobacco, Leaf .1 g/mL
Nicotiana tabacum · SOLUTION · Greer Laboratories, Inc.
Tobacco leaf solution is an over-the-counter product administered by intradermal injection at a concentration of 0.1 g/mL. This product contains nicotine, a stimulant alkaloid derived from tobacco plants.
